1. Causes of Key Stuck in Ignition

Numerous concerns can cause a key getting stuck in the ignition. Here are some of the most common causes:

CauseDescription
Ignition Cylinder ProblemsUse and tear on the Ignition Key Repair cylinder can prevent the key from turning or being removed easily.
Faulty Ignition SwitchA malfunctioning ignition switch may hold the type in place and avoid it from being turned.
Steering Wheel LockIf the guiding wheel is locked, it can in some cases cause concerns with the ignition key.
Worn-out KeyA worn-out or damaged key can hinder ignition engagement and removal.
Dead BatteryElectrical problems, consisting of a dead battery, can cause the ignition system to malfunction.
Transmission LockIn cars with automatic transmission, the gear shifter might require to be in "Park" to remove the key.

2. Fixing Steps

If you discover that your key is stuck in the ignition, do not panic. Here are some troubleshooting actions you can take before looking for professional aid:

StepAction
Step 1: Check the GearIf driving an automated, ensure that the vehicle is in 'Park'. For manual lorries, guarantee it is in neutral.
Step 2: Examine the KeyCheck the key for any noticeable damage or wear. If it's bent or broken, it may not work correctly.
Action 3: Wiggle the Steering WheelIn some cases, merely moving the guiding wheel left and right can release the lock feature.
Step 4: Check the BatteryIf the cockpit console lights are dim or non-functional, consider jump-starting or replacing the battery.
Step 5: Turn the Wheel SlightlyAttempt gently turning the guiding wheel while trying to eliminate the Flip Key Repair; this might help if there's a lock issue.
Action 6: Look for DebrisExamine for any particles or grime around the ignition cylinder that might be causing blockage.

3. Repair Options

If the troubleshooting actions do not solve the issue, it might be time to consider repair alternatives. Below is a list of possible services:

Repair OptionDescription
Ignition Cylinder ReplacementIf the ignition cylinder is too used out, replacing it might be required to deal with the key stuck issue.
Ignition Switch Repair/ReplacementA faulty ignition switch may require repairs or total replacement depending upon its condition.
Key ReplacementIf the key is used or harmed, getting a new key from the dealer or a locksmith professional can fix the issue.
Steering Column AdjustmentIf the steering lock is the factor behind the issue, a professional may require to adjust the guiding column.

5.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can I drive with the key stuck in the ignition?

Driving with a key stuck in the ignition is not suggested. You may run the risk of damaging the ignition system or electrical wiring.

2. What should I do if the battery is dead but the key is stuck?

If the key is stuck due to a dead battery, first attempt jump-starting the vehicle or replacing the battery. If the key is still stuck, you might require to speak with a mechanic.

3. Is it safe to utilize lubricants on the ignition cylinder?

While some regular lubricants might help, it's best to utilize specialized ignition lock lubricants. Do not use oil or grease, as they can draw in dirt and debris.

4. Just how much does it normally cost to replace an ignition cylinder?

Expenses can vary extensively based upon the make and design of your vehicle, however normally, ignition cylinder replacement can range from ₤ 150 to ₤ 500, including labor.

5. Can I fix a key stuck in the ignition myself?

If you're comfortable with fundamental mechanical tasks, you can try the fixing methods described above. If the issue persists, seeking advice from an expert is suggested.
